Output 3ae2573844d46695e406d904d7c55e5d81dd2f30a0148391c83b5be014e5b3aa:0

value
19946856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87aa9c2b8b782141fb215b22213f222ce46d0b63 OP_EQUAL
address
3E4MXdjmMTNSeeRAyJBoBZSb963yrcYgYg
transaction
3ae2573844d46695e406d904d7c55e5d81dd2f30a0148391c83b5be014e5b3aa
spent
true